Thankfully all pieces were still in the box, so I removed the stock exhaust and installed the N1 catback.
I used floor jacks to get the car up, then placed car stands beneath the car to keep it up safely. The entire process took roughly 1.5 - 2 hours to complete. The exhaust sounds absolutely amazing, I recommend it to all who are looking into getting a custom exhaust. Ideally, I'd like a smooth roof. However, the roof is where the radio antenna is located for this car. So I've changed the look of my roof quite dramatically.
I removed the "carbon fiber" vinyl wrap and replaced the stock antenna with a shark fin antenna. The wrap scratched easily and I'd rather have real carbon fiber than some fake wallpaper thing. I went with a shark fin antenna due to the fact that the stock antenna gave the car a RC look IMO. Attachment 87073 I bought the antenna from F-T on these forums. |
